The first time you buy or sell on the AgroYield Marketplace you’ll see a one-time Marketplace Agreement dialog. This article explains what’s in it, why we ask, and how to access it later.
When you see the agreement
The agreement appears the first time you initiate a value exchange — today that means clicking Buy now on a Marketplace listing. We don’t ask before browsing, saving listings, or messaging sellers. We only ask when actual money is about to move.
After you accept, you won’t see the dialog again unless we publish a new version with material changes (a price-of-platform change, a refund-policy update, or any other change to the terms you originally accepted). When that happens, you’ll re-acknowledge before your next purchase.
What’s in the agreement
The current Marketplace Agreement covers seven sections:
- Escrow and payment flow — we hold buyer payments via Monnify until you confirm delivery or seven days elapse, whichever is sooner.
- Platform commission — the current commission rate is shown transparently on every listing’s checkout, and is deducted from the seller’s payout (not added to the buyer’s total).
- Refunds and disputes — how disputes work, the timeline, and the path of escalation.
- Listing accuracy — sellers warrant the listing details (price, quantity, condition, location) are accurate at time of posting.
- Lawful use — the platform isn’t for restricted goods or services.
- Liability — we mediate disputes but we’re not a party to the underlying sale.
- Version changes — how we notify you when terms change.
You can read the full text of the current version any time at agroyield.africa/legal/marketplace.
Where your acceptance lives
When you click Accept and continue in the dialog, three things happen:
- The acceptance is recorded in our database with a timestamp, the agreement version you accepted, your IP address, and your browser user-agent — so we can prove you accepted version X on date Y if a dispute ever arises.
- We send you an email with the full agreement body inline, so you have a searchable copy in your inbox.
- We send you a direct message in your AgroYield inbox confirming the acceptance, with a link to read the agreement again.
If the email or DM doesn’t land for any reason (Resend down, delivery failure, etc.), the acceptance is still recorded — the email and DM are convenience copies, not the source of truth.
What if I don’t accept?
You can dismiss the dialog and continue browsing the Marketplace. You won’t be able to complete a purchase until you’ve accepted, and you’ll see the dialog again the next time you click Buy now. There’s no penalty for taking time to read the terms before accepting.
Other value-exchange agreements
The Marketplace Agreement is the first of several value-exchange agreements we’ll roll out as new modules ship:
- Mentorship agreement — for paid mentorship sessions (rolling out alongside the mentorship monetisation milestone).
- Rentals agreement — for the equipment rental marketplace.
- Grants agreement — for grant disbursements that flow through AgroYield.
Each is scoped narrowly to its module and only fires when you initiate a transaction in that module — we don’t ask you to accept terms you don’t need.
